MAIN DUTIES

    • Convey the meaning, tone, and emotional impact of lyrics rather than providing word-for-word translations.
    • Understand the artist’s background, genre, and cultural context to ensure authenticity.
    • Reflect the original mood of the lyrics using natural phrasing in the target language.
    • Adapt lyrics to align with local market norms and guidelines, especially in sensitive regions.
    • Use regionally appropriate language without over-localizing or distorting the original meaning.
    • Translate idioms and slang in culturally equivalent ways that retain their meaning and vibe.
    • Retain unique artist-created words and ensure lyrical rhythm and flow.
